AlphaX RE Capital, in partnership with the City of San José and Mayor Matt Mahan, is proud to announce the completion of California’s first-ever Accessory Dwelling Unit (ADU) condominium conversion, a historic milestone made possible by AB 1033.    


For the first time in state history, an ADU can now be sold separately from its main residence, creating a groundbreaking pathway to more affordable homeownership. San José was the first city in California to adopt AB 1033, setting a bold precedent for other municipalities to follow.    


With this change, Founder & CEO Stephanie Yi shares that AlphaX can deliver ownership opportunities at more attainable price points, helping families build equity, stability, and a future.    


This milestone builds on AlphaX’s track record of pioneering housing solutions in California:   

• First ADU condominium conversion in the state (San José, August 2025)   

• Our own first AB 684 approval in Campbell (August 2025)   

• We had our first SB 9 lot split approval in the state (Atherton, 2022)    


As Chief Asset Manager Jia Li notes, being a pioneer means solving challenges head-on—unlocking opportunities for both communities and investors. Echoing this, Chief Investment Officer Jane Lin emphasizes that ADU condo conversions are just one of many solutions AlphaX is advancing to address California’s housing shortage.    


Looking ahead, we plan to complete 86 ADU condominiums over the next year, expanding affordable homeownership across the state.
